Chapter 3 - Chapter 3: Race Against Fate

Horitake grappled with the system's explanation. "I get it—my better character spared Gyomei from prison, a positive butterfly effect. But mastering Thunder Breathing's First Form is good too! Why's it negative?"

The system's flat voice echoed in his mind: "Butterfly effects involve unpredictable causality. Positive and negative outcomes each have a fifty percent chance."

"Fine. What's this negative effect I caused?"

"Ding! By mastering Thunder Breathing's First Form, you've triggered a negative butterfly effect: the protagonists, Tanjiro Kamado and Nezuko Kamado, face imminent death!"

"What?!" Horitake leapt up, heart racing. "My future wife and brother-in-law are gonna die because I learned First Form?! I wouldn't have if I'd known! What do I do?!"

Wailing in the snow, he forced himself to calm down, thinking frantically. "I wasn't thorough watching the anime—I don't know where the Kamados live. I couldn't find them! How do I save them? My wife! My brother-in-law!"

A spark hit. "Kisatsume Mountain! They're heading there! I'll track that direction. The old man must know where it is! And Tomioka Giyu—he's met them by now. He could help! But… is there time? System, what does 'imminent' mean? How long do I have?"

The system's tone seemed almost exasperated. "Ding! Calm down, host. My purpose includes helping you resolve negative butterfly effects."

"Then hurry up!"

"Ding! Task issued: Prevent the negative butterfly effect—save Tanjiro and Nezuko Kamado from death. My navigation function will guide you to them. Your current strength, with caution, is sufficient to face their threat. Note: 24 hours remain until their death. Act swiftly.

Reward: Advanced Thunder Breathing First Form: Thunderclap and Flash.

Penalty: Tanjiro and Nezuko die, you lose your future wife and brother-in-law, fate shifts drastically, and butterfly effects collapse further."

Horitake stared, piecing it together. Positive effects were ignored; negative ones triggered tasks he'd solve, with rewards to grow stronger. Brilliant!

A 24-hour countdown appeared in his vision's corner. "Nice work, system! I'm off!"

He sprinted home, bursting into Jigoro's house, nearly toppling the door. Grabbing supplies, he shouted, "Old man, I'm taking this coat—it's warm! Your spare Nichirin Blade too! And these rice balls for the road!"

Jigoro's forehead pulsed with veins. "What are you doing, brat?!"

Horitake, already packed, bolted down the mountain. Jigoro yelled from the doorway, "What's going on? Where are you going? When are you back?"

From the trees, Horitake's voice echoed, "Finding my future wife and brother-in-law! Don't worry, back in a few days!"

Jigoro, stunned, blinked. "Wife? Brother-in-law? I didn't know about this! Was this why he kept leaving?" Petals swirled as he daydreamed, "Good for him, thinking of marriage. Wonder what the girl's like—pretty? Kind? Worthy of my brat?"

Meanwhile, Horitake raced along the system's guided path, heart pounding. I'll make it. The system wouldn't give me an impossible task. Using Thunder Breathing's rhythm, he stretched his stamina and speed, possibly nearing Total Concentration Breathing. Nezuko, my future wife, you'll be fine! Tanjiro, you too—can't let the plot derail, or my foresight's useless!

He ran for 24 hours, eating rice balls when hungry, sipping stream water when thirsty, resting briefly when exhausted. Sleep? No time.

As the countdown neared its end, what danger loomed for the Kamados? Normally, their journey to Kisatsume Mountain faced only a temple demon at the end. But this negative butterfly effect brought a new threat—a demon with unique powers.

"Nezuko!" Tanjiro's desperate cry rang out.

The protective brother was now protected. A demon ambushed them on their path, too strong for Tanjiro. Nezuko, now a demon herself, fought fiercely to shield him. Clutching his bleeding arm, axe in hand, Tanjiro watched helplessly as Nezuko battled the demon evenly.

The demon wasn't overwhelmingly strong, but its special ability had injured Tanjiro. Staring it down, he saw its mouth open and shouted, "Watch out!"

The demon spat four fangs like darts. Nezuko dodged, but one struck her back.
